Yesterday's rainfall totals show a north/south split for the Region, with locations on the South Coast barely registering any rain.

1257051179_RainfallTotalHiResRadar10Mar.thumb.png.e9cea782e0e79506d32ce88dcb36ef76.png

So far this morning plenty of 50+ mph wind gusts across the Region, with Rochester in Kent currently recording the strongest gust at 58mph.

837850942_RadarThur11Mar07_10.thumb.jpg.1d58e05bb3d6cb79ce1089e121004776.jpg

Charts: Netweather Extra HiRes Radar

Strongest gusts up to 09.00 in the East:

  • 61mph Bedford + Wittering
  • 60mph Marham + Weybourne
  • 59mph Tibenham 58mph Andrewsfield + Southend-on-Sea
  • 55mph Luton, Mildenhall, Norwich Airport + Wattisham
  • 54mph Shoeburyness
  • 53mph Lakenheath + Monks Wood
  • 48mph Stansted

Figures from Dan Holley, Weatherquest. Twitter @danholley_
